Stir-fried Beef Bulgogi with Bok Choy and Octopus
Succulent Octopus & Beef Bulgogi Stir-fry with Bok Choy
A delightful main dish featuring tender beef bulgogi, chewy octopus, and crisp bok choy. This flavorful stir-fry is perfect for special occasions or a satisfying weeknight meal.
Main Ingredients
- 500g Beef (Bulgogi cut)
- 310g Cooked Octopus
- 1 stalk Scallion (Green onion)
- 4 heads Bok Choy
Marinade
- 1/2 Apple
- 1/2 Onion
- 5 Tbsp Soy Sauce
- 1 Tbsp Sugar
- 2 Tbsp Oligodang (Corn syrup or similar)
- 1 Tbsp Minced Garlic
- 1 Tbsp Maesil Cheong (Plum extract)
- Pinch of Black Pepper
- 2 Tbsp Mirin (or cooking wine)

Cooking Instructions
Step 1
Gently pat the beef dry with paper towels to remove any excess blood. This step is crucial for a clean, non-gamey flavor. Slice the beef into bite-sized pieces and place them in a bowl.
Step 2
In a blender, purée half an apple and half an onion. Combine this purée with 5 Tbsp soy sauce, 1 Tbsp minced garlic, 1 Tbsp sugar, 2 Tbsp oligodang, a pinch of black pepper, 2 Tbsp mirin, and 1 Tbsp maesil cheong to create the flavorful marinade.
Step 3
Add the beef to the marinade and mix well by hand, ensuring every piece is coated evenly. Let it marinate while you prepare the other ingredients.
Step 4
Wash the bok choy thoroughly under running water. Trim off the tough ends. Slice the scallion diagonally. Cut the cooked octopus into bite-sized pieces. (Tip: For instructions on how to cook octopus, refer to [@6897162].)
Step 5
Once all ingredients are prepped, heat a pan over medium heat and add the marinated beef. Stir-fry, breaking up any clumps, until the beef is mostly cooked.
Step 6
When the beef is nearly done, add the prepared octopus and sliced scallions to the pan.
Step 7
Stir-fry quickly over high heat, allowing the flavors to meld and the octopus and scallions to cook through. Keep things moving to maintain a good texture.
Step 8
Finally, add the cleaned bok choy and 1 Tbsp of oyster sauce.
Step 9
Stir-fry rapidly over high heat for just a minute or two, until the bok choy is slightly wilted but still crisp. Be careful not to overcook it, as it can become watery. A quick toss is all it needs to retain its vibrant color and satisfying crunch.
Step 10
Transfer the delicious stir-fried beef bulgogi with bok choy and octopus to a serving plate. Enjoy this flavorful dish with a side of warm rice for a complete and satisfying meal!
